Transaction 234328ae25e66c943b7de4aae100c3adcc166499ad47564c2b23630a8fc31969
1 Input
1 Output
-
234328ae25e66c943b7de4aae100c3adcc166499ad47564c2b23630a8fc31969:0
- value
- 136008
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5d813576b73d2716a7379d93994013dcf047322
- address
- bc1qchvpx4mtw0f8z6nn08vnn9qp8h8sguezxmffyl